We used to play VALORANT together months (maybe a year) ago without any problems. Recently, we tried to get back into the game, but Vanguard is now blocking him with error VA9003, which requires Secure Boot to be enabled.

Here’s the problem:

  • He tried enabling Secure Boot (UEFI) in the BIOS
  • After doing that, his PC shows a red screen error saying something like verification failed, and he can’t boot into the system
  • He had to revert the changes just to use his PC again

He even took the PC to a technician, but they couldn’t fix it. The technician suggested it might be a motherboard issue and even mentioned possibly needing to replace it, which seems a bit extreme.

So we’re wondering:

  • Is there any workaround for Vanguard’s Secure Boot requirement?
  • Could this be related to TPM, BIOS version, or GPU firmware instead of the motherboard?
  • Has anyone experienced the red screen Secure Boot verification failure and fixed it without replacing hardware?
